I hesitated for so long before finally purchasing this DVD due to the negative reviews posted. Finally I bought it as there is a discount of 54%. Guess what? The DVD is in Dolby Surround Stereo and not MONO as stated. On my home theatre system, I can hear Streisand's voice on my centre speaker whereas the other sounds come from the left and right speakers as well as my rear speakers.
br /The image is in widescreen. I don't remember the aspect ratio in the cinemas so I cannot comment if the image has been cropped. The quality of the image is excellent with very minor specks. At the present discounted price, this DVD is a real bargain. Who knows when the Streisand colour-approved DVD will be released in USA. Even "A Star Is Born" has been delayed so many times. Why wait when this DVD is a quality product?

A young girl in Eastern Europe in 1900's is so desperate to have more than is being offered to her while amoungst her Jewish community. After the sudden death of her father she decides to set out to find just those things...but can only achieve this while disguised as a young man. There is a Shakespares 'Twelth night' twist to this film. When on her enlightening journey she falls in love with a fellow scholar. This film shows what extents people will go to when in love. It is a beautiful film which is also funny and moving with the amazing sound of Barbra Streisands' voice.

This is one of Streisands screen triumphs, in which she stars in, directs and also provides the vocal score for the soundtrack.pA personal tribute to her late father, each scene is beautifully photographed with close attention to detail such as colour and texture and form.pVery clever in the way the vocals are portrayed. When she is thinking to herself as Yentl, the music is in the background, when she is alone her thoughts come out in the form of audible song.pAs a director, she does not hog the limelight - as some divas would be tempted to do.
